Qualifications
- Graduate of an accredited school of Registered Nursing required, BSN preferred.
- Current license to practice as a Registered Nurse in the State of Washington. (May be a multi-State license from a Compact state or a Washington license.)
- Healthcare provider CPR Certification required.
- Current experience in the operating room as circulator, with competency in a scrub role preferred.
- CNOR certification preferred.
- Excellent customer service and communication skills required.
Note - RNs hired into units that require a competency in cardiac rhythm interpretation will be required to take a rhythm assessment in their first week. This will include standard cardiac rhythms, dysrhythmias and paced rhythms.

How much will this job pay?
Posted pay ranges represent the entire pay scale, from minimum to maximum. For jobs with more than one level, the posted range reflects the minimum of the lowest level and the maximum of the highest level. Some positions also offer additional pay based on shift, certifications or degrees. Job offers are determined based on a candidate's years of relevant experience, level of education and internal equity.
